What is Great Resignation

The Great Resignation is an economic trend that started in 2021, which primarily involved people voluntarily leaving their jobs. Some of the factors that triggered it were the rising cost of living and the COVID-19 pandemic.

Economy Background

In the years preceding the pandemic, the US’ monthly resignation rate never exceeded 2.4%. This indicates that workers are confident in their abilities to secure higher-paid jobs.

During times of high unemployment, the rate of resignations tends to decrease. During the Great Recession, the rate of resignations decreased from 2.9% to 1.3%.

And during the first few months of the COVID-19 pandemic, the resignation rate in the US fell to a seven-year low of 1.6%. Many workers (mostly women), who worked in industries affected by lockdown, were laid off during the pandemic.

United States

In April 2021, it was reported that the number of Americans who quit their jobs reached a record high. In June, about 3.9 million people left their jobs due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The South experienced the highest rate of resignation at 3.3%.

In October 2021, the Bureau of Labor Statistics stated that the number of foodservice workers who quit their jobs increased to 6.8%, which is higher than the industry average of 4.1% in the last 20 years.

In 2021, over 40% of the global workforce stated that they were considering leaving their jobs and 65% of the employees stated that they were looking for a job. A lack of skilled workers is one of the biggest challenges facing companies.

In October, hundreds of thousands of American workers started a strike wave known as Striketober. It was triggered by the Great Resignation.

In December, the average wage growth in the US reached 4.5%, which was the highest since 2001. Companies like McDonald’s even offered better benefits, such as healthcare and college scholarships.
